Djokovic dominated the Melbourne final

The world ranking First from Serbia makes the Scot Andy Murray in the final of the Australian Open, no Chance. Murray loses for the fifth Time already, the final game in Melbourne.

After 2:53 hours it was all over. With an ACE and ended Novak Djokovic in the final of the Australian Open. A clenched fist, a short Handshake for Andy Murray, a kiss for the covering of the Center Courts in Melbourne, a hug with Coach Boris Becker. Everything was so naturally, so easily. Murray, in the world ranking on Position two at least, right behind Djokovic placed, had no Chance. With the 6:1, 7:5 and 7:6 (7:3) was won by the Serbian for the sixth Time the title at the first Grand Slam tournament of the year.

Djokovic castle to Melbourne record winner Roy Emerson on, also for six times and was successful. Overall, it was even his eleventh Grand-Slam success. So, he lies in the eternal ranking already on place five. “It is a great honor, in the circle of this Large,” said the Serb at the awards ceremony and did not even take his Finanlgegner to praise: “You’re a great Champion,” he said to Murray, he has a good relationship maintains, “you’ll still have more chances.”
